Final answer:

To solve for the time t, we use the quadratic formula by rearranging the equation and substituting values into the formula.

Step-by-step explanation:

To solve for the time t, we need to use an equation that has only one unknown variable. Let's consider the quadratic equation t² + 10t - 2000 = 0 as an example. In this equation, we need to rearrange it to have 0 on one side, which gives t² + 10t - 2000 = 0. Now we can use the quadratic formula to solve for t.

Identify the coefficients in the equation: a = 1, b = 10, and c = -2000.

Use the quadratic formula: t = (-b ± √(b² - 4ac)) / (2a).

Substitute the values into the formula and simplify to find the solutions for t.

So, by using the quadratic formula, we can find the values of t that satisfy the equation.
